It increases customer loyalty

Mystery boxes are an excellent way to increase customer loyalty and foster brand recognition. This is because they allow customers to experience the thrill of the unknown, creating a sense of anticipation and excitement. In addition, they can also increase average order value and customer satisfaction by offering a curated collection of products. In addition, customers frequently share their unboxing experiences on social media, further driving brand recognition.

It is vital to understand your audience's preferences and identify them to create an effective mystery box. Performing market research will aid in determining a theme that resonates with your audience and curate a variety of top-quality products. Include a personal touch to your packaging, such as a special offer or a note. Additionally, you must provide the best mystery boxes possible delivery experience by working with a reliable logistics service.

Another method that works is to let buyers resell their unopened mystery box on a marketplace like Facebook, Poshmark, or Depop. This allows customers the opportunity to recoup costs and make a profit. This can boost sales. However, it is important to clearly state your policy on reselling mystery boxes and make sure that customers aren't being misled.

You can also encourage repeat purchases by offering exclusive products in your mystery box or by offering limited-time subscription offers. This can result in an increase in new subscribers, and boost your sales and the average order value.

Increases Brand Recognition

Mystery boxes encourage customers to discover new products that they may not have considered before. Brands can make use of mystery boxes to showcase their entire range of products.

The sense of value buyers get when they purchase an item at a reduced price is one of the main factors that draws people to mystery boxes. The value of the items included in the mystery box is typically greater than the price of the box, creating the impression that you're getting more for your money. Businesses should carefully curate their mystery boxes to ensure that the items are relevant and appealing to target audiences.

When designing a mystery boxes for a brand, they should include items that are well-known and are likely to draw customers. They should also include unique or exclusive items that add the feeling of surprise and delight. Combining both will make customers happy and encourage them to return for more.

Finally, a mystery box can be used to promote a brand by encouraging customers to share their unboxing experiences on social media. This can boost the visibility of a company, build brand loyalty, and foster a sense of community between customers. Brands should keep track of the feedback of customers and purchases in relation to their mystery boxes to get a better understanding of the strategies for promotion.

Pop Mart, a Chinese toy company, sells so many figurines each year due to the fact that they sell them in mystery boxes at a discounted price. These mystery boxes are now a popular feature on TikTok, and have helped the best mystery boxes company achieve an estimated value of a billion dollars in a few short years.
